I bought a CD yesterday. Its been a loooong time since I’ve bought a cd from the store. Nowadays, with everyone downloading music and iPods, who really buys cds anymore. But I do make it a point to support my favorite artists because I truly appreciate their craft and talent. So … I bought Drake’s new CD, Thank me Later. Before yesterday, I have enjoyed his music but I have been very indifferent about Drake himself. No opinions whatsoever. But once I listened to the first track, I was very pleased with my purchase. The entire album is good. I cannot remember the last time that I really enjoyed a CD this much! Its been a while, maybe the Alicia Keys album a couple years ago. I can’t stop listening to it. In the car, on the phone, in the shower. I don’t know what it is about this album, but it touches a cord with me. Then, last night I saw his hour long documentary “Better than Good Enough” and  officially became a fan. I was truly touched by some of the things he shared, his work ethic, and his perspective on life. For a twenty three year old, he definitely has a few things figured out ;)
